Did you know that a Walmart rotisserie chicken from their deli costs a whole dollar more for fewer ounces?
Each Sam’s Club rotisserie chicken is 2.75 pounds, while one from Walmart is 2.25 pounds. It’s worth grabbing one during your Sam’s Club trip, even if your family won’t eat it all in one go, since you can cut and freeze the leftovers to save more cash.
Save over $5 on the same exact body wash by buying a twin-pack at Sam’s Club instead.
At Walmart, one bottle costs $9.97, but for $5.51 more, you can get two value-sized pump bottles of Dove body wash for you and your spouse.
This is a more budget-friendly purchase that can last, which also saves you trips to the store.

8. Dog food
Price: $42.98
If you buy a similar premium brand of dog food from Walmart, you’re paying more for less.
Sam's Club lamb and brown rice dog food is $42.98 for 35 pounds, whereas the Walmart Pure Balance brand is $55 for 30 pounds.
You save over $12 by shopping this pet food at Sam’s Club, and it will last you longer, too.
9. Pasta
Price: $8.52
Stock up on pasta at Sam’s Club to save over $0.40 a box. At Walmart, one box of Barilla's elbows is $1.84, while this variety pack of elbows, spaghetti, and penne at Sam’s is $1.42 a box.
So, not only do you get more variety at Sam’s Club to mix things up, but you also save big in the long run.
If you bought comparable paper towels at Walmart, you’d only be getting 110 sheets per roll, whereas Sam’s Club offers 150 per roll.
With this deal, you can save even more time and money in the long run by stocking up on Member’s Mark two-ply paper towels.
Plus, the Sam’s Club version has 4.9 stars in reviews, while Walmart’s has a 4.7 one.
